The international Conference on “Molecules at the Mirror: Chirality in Chemistry and Biophysics” was held at the Accademia dei Lincei, Palazzo Corsini, Rome, 29–30 October 2012. It was organized by the Academicians V. Aquilanti (Perugia), M. Catellani (Parma), V. Schettino (Florence), A. Zecchina (Turin), with the support of the Fondazione Guido Donegani and the auspices of the Italian Chemical Society (SCI).

The theme of the Conference, Molecular Chirality, pervades several areas of pure and applied science. The focus was on a sequence of topics including: (1) the basic biochemical and physicochemical aspects regarding structure and transformations of chiral molecules; (2) the organic and industrial chemistry of chiral recognition, asymmetric synthesis and heterogeneous catalysis, which are of prime interest for pharmaceutical and materials sciences; (3) the ubiquitous manifestations of molecular chirality in Nature, and specifically biological homochirality: most of the molecules found in living organisms have a well-defined handedness, for example all amino acids are left-handed, while sugars are right-handed. Extensive current efforts aiming at clarifying the origin of the phenomenon are relevant to key questions on the evolution of life.

Examples recording the curiosity of mankind about the symmetry relationship between an object and its mirror image can be traced back in arts and science since the birth of civilization.

The nineteenth century witnessed an impressive sequence of investigations, among which we quote here the crucial contributions from three major scientists active in widely separated fields: the mathematical formulation by Moebius, the astonishing discovery by Pasteur of selective “handedness” in matter at the molecular level (notably in biologically occurring substances), and the research on problems from physics by Lord Kelvin. The latter is also responsible for the introduction of the word chirality (from χείρ, Greek for hand), which comprehends a concept that nowadays appears transversally across many disciplines.

In the twentieth century, overwhelming evidence was accumulated that selective chirality governs the organic chemistry of biologically active molecules: familiar examples include the exclusive left handedness of amino acids and the right handedness of natural sugars, electing molecular homochirality as a signature of life at the molecular level. Physicists discovered that chirality acts selectively only when interactions designated as “weak nuclear forces” are operative. Since these forces are traditionally considered irrelevant in chemistry, the fact that biology distinguishes molecules and their mirror images is an intriguing theoretical challenge for the twenty first century—but not the only one: well known are implications for pharmaceutical sciences, and in general for applied chemistry. Indeed chirality-related issues involve a large fraction of world’s research and industrial budget.
